// src/hover-card/utils.ts
function getHoverCardSafeArea(placement, anchorEl, floatingEl) {
const basePlacement = placement.split("-")[0];
const anchorRect = anchorEl.getBoundingClientRect();
const floatingRect = floatingEl.getBoundingClientRect();
const polygon = [];
const anchorCenterX = anchorRect.left + anchorRect.width / 2;
const anchorCenterY = anchorRect.top + anchorRect.height / 2;
switch (basePlacement) {
case "top":
polygon.push([anchorRect.left, anchorCenterY]);
polygon.push([floatingRect.left, floatingRect.bottom]);
polygon.push([floatingRect.left, floatingRect.top]);
polygon.push([floatingRect.right, floatingRect.top]);
polygon.push([floatingRect.right, floatingRect.bottom]);
polygon.push([anchorRect.right, anchorCenterY]);
break;
case "right":
polygon.push([anchorCenterX, anchorRect.top]);
polygon.push([floatingRect.left, floatingRect.top]);
polygon.push([floatingRect.right, floatingRect.top]);
polygon.push([floatingRect.right, floatingRect.bottom]);
polygon.push([floatingRect.left, floatingRect.bottom]);
polygon.push([anchorCenterX, anchorRect.bottom]);
break;
case "bottom":
polygon.push([anchorRect.left, anchorCenterY]);
polygon.push([floatingRect.left, floatingRect.top]);
polygon.push([floatingRect.left, floatingRect.bottom]);
polygon.push([floatingRect.right, floatingRect.bottom]);
polygon.push([floatingRect.right, floatingRect.top]);
polygon.push([anchorRect.right, anchorCenterY]);
break;
case "left":
polygon.push([anchorCenterX, anchorRect.top]);
polygon.push([floatingRect.right, floatingRect.top]);
polygon.push([floatingRect.left, floatingRect.top]);
polygon.push([floatingRect.left, floatingRect.bottom]);
polygon.push([floatingRect.right, floatingRect.bottom]);
polygon.push([anchorCenterX, anchorRect.bottom]);
break;
}
return polygon;
}
